2025 International Series Macau Highlights LIV Golf's Path to Major Championships
The $2 million tournament at Macau Golf and Country Club offers three Open Championship spots, attracting top LIV Golf players like Sergio Garcia and Patrick Reed.
- The 2025 International Series Macau, part of the Asian Tour, is underway with a $2 million prize purse and three qualifying spots for The Open Championship.
- Sergio Garcia, fresh off a win in Hong Kong, enters as a favorite alongside other LIV Golf stars like Patrick Reed, Abraham Ancer, and David Puig.
- Defending champion John Catlin returns after making history last year with the first sub-60 round in Asian Tour history.
- The tournament is part of a $300 million collaboration between LIV Golf and the Asian Tour to elevate golf in Asia and provide alternative pathways to major championships.
